I have 3 tags.

Fish - Green
Ok - Orange
Good - Purple

Don't see the need to tag people due to play styles if you run a HUD (which you should if you plan on playing a decent amount of online poker).

As for notes I take loads. Mainly on things such as sizings....etc if I notice anything out of the norm / people who make bad check backs...etc.
